Primary Responsibilities /Accountabilities/ Essential Functions:

  • Own SEO performance for assigned verticals and content types.
  • Conduct keyword gap analyses, competitive research, and user intent mapping to identify opportunities.
  • Perform advanced on-page and technical SEO audits (e.g., indexation, internal linking, site architecture).
  • Recommend new pages, content refreshes, or additional SEO initiatives related to owned verticals
  • Support testing initiatives and set up lightweight experiments (e.g., different title formats, content structures) and track results over time.
  • Identify and resolve SEO issues such as duplicate content, crawl errors, slow-loading pages, and broken links.
  • Collaborate with content, UX, and development teams to guide SEO implementation and monitor progress.
  • Maintain and update SEO documentation, keyword maps, and internal SOPs for owned verticals.
  • Report on SEO performance trends and provide actionable insights during regular updates.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Equipment Used and Responsibility

  • Strong understanding of technical SEO, keyword strategy, and content optimization.
  • Experience using SEO tools such as Google Search Console, Google Analytics, SEMrush, Ahrefs, Screaming Frog, or similar.
  • Proven ability to prioritize tasks, meet deadlines, and manage multiple projects independently.
  • Comfort interpreting data, identifying patterns, and drawing actionable conclusions.
  • Ability to communicate effectively with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Familiarity with CMS platforms (e.g., Drupal, WordPress) and basic HTML/CSS.
  • Understanding of how SEO integrates with CRO, UX, and web development processes.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
